Output 24defd6b10c2fa9b1fccd2abe159ebcd591b689687a51f2d62be767724b8d670:1

value
79267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dc4d930dd39a592bf7fb24035b5d611b77a308 OP_EQUAL
address
3ESXm8XyqVADfcEZkWXwyae3ouEZkCDrHd
transaction
24defd6b10c2fa9b1fccd2abe159ebcd591b689687a51f2d62be767724b8d670
confirmations
389609
spent
true